OLD FASHIONED ROLLED DUMPLINGS

Old fashioned rolled dumplings good with chicken or stews. My grandma always made them with fruit compote or tomatoes.

Time 30m

Yield 4-6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 6

2 cups all-purpose flour
2 teaspoons baking powder
1 teaspoon salt
1/3 cup shortening
1/2 cup milk
5 cups broth or 5 cups juice

Steps:

  • Combine flour, baking powder and salt. Cut in shortening and add milk to make a stiff dough.
  • Roll out to about 1/8 inch thickness and cut into 1 inch squares, 1 to 1 1/2 inch strips or diamonds. Sprinkle lightly with flour and drop into boiling broth or juice. Cover tightly and boil gently for 8 to 10 minutes.
